Cancel Button
If you wish to interrupt the toasting process,
p
ress the Cancel Button
(
6)
.
The Cancel Button
i
lluminates during the toasting cycle.
Re-heat Button
If your toast has popped up and gone cold, the
t
oaster offers a re-heat facility. To use, depress
Bread Carriage Levers
(1 & 3) (depending on how
m
any slices of bread require re-heating), and
press the Re-heat Button
(7) immediately. The
button will illuminate and the toaster will operate
for a short period, reheating the bread.
Frozen Button
To toast frozen bread, do not adjust the Browning
C
ontrol
(
8)
f
rom your normal setting. Place the
frozen bread in the Bread Slots
(2 & 4), depress
t
he Bread Carriage Levers
(
1 & 3)
a
nd press the
D
efrost Button
(
9)
.
The button will illuminate and
the toaster will operate for a longer period,
defrosting and toasting the bread.
Additional features
WARNING: Crumbs will accumulate in the Crumb Trays (5) and could catch fire if not
emptied regularly.
Removing the Crumb Tray
1. When the appliance has cooled down completely,
tap the sides of the case lightly to dislodge any
crumbs stuck in the Bread Slots (2 & 4).
2. Press the Crumb Trays to unlock and remove
from the toaster.
3. Empty the Crumb Trays and replace, push to lock
back into place.
Never operate the appliance without the
Crumb Trays fitted.
